2020年最簡單V2Ray+caddy偽裝翻牆避免特徵被檢測:Websocket+TLS+V2Ray+Web的搭建|freenom免費域名最新教程|官方命令非腳本,安全無木馬,穩定不斷網,ip不被封



2020年最新最簡單V2Ray+caddy偽裝翻牆:Websocket+TLS+V2Ray+Web的搭建|freenom免費域名最新教程||谷歌雲或VPS上的最安全科學上網,無特徵被檢測。再也不用擔心被特徵檢測和VPS被封。

官方命令非腳本安裝,不用擔心木馬

放棄VPN和SSR吧! 自從這樣配置後,一直很穩定,不會像普通的v2ray或其他VPN時斷時續,也不用擔心被特徵檢測封了ip。

谷歌雲申請+v2ray搭建,可看之前的視頻:

電報群:https://t.me/ytmoney2

教程:
1. freenom 免費域名+地址解析
ytvideo2.tk

2. 安裝web伺服器+域名證書
2.1 安裝Caddy
2.1.1 安裝curl
Debian 或Ubuntu用戶
sudo apt update
sudo apt upgrade
sudo apt install curl
CentOS用戶
sudo yum update
sudo yum install curl
檢查curl安裝位置:
which curl
2.1.2 安裝caddy(https://www.cloudbooklet.com/install-caddy-with-php-https-using-letsencrypt-on-ubuntu/)
curl https://getcaddy.com | sudo bash -s personal tls.dns.cloudflare
檢查
which caddy

sudo apt-get install libcap2-bin
sudo setcap cap_net_bind_service=+ep /usr/local/bin/caddy

2.1.3 配置caddy
sudo mkdir /etc/caddy
sudo mkdir /etc/ssl/caddy
sudo mkdir /var/log/caddy

sudo chown -R root:root /etc/caddy
sudo chown -R root:www-data /etc/ssl/caddy
sudo chown -R root:www-data /var/log/caddy
sudo chmod 0770 /etc/ssl/caddy

 wget https://raw.githubusercontent.com/caddyserver/caddy/master/dist/init/linux-systemd/caddy.service
sudo cp caddy.service /etc/systemd/system/
sudo chown root:root /etc/systemd/system/caddy.service
sudo chmod 644 /etc/systemd/system/caddy.service
sudo systemctl daemon-reload

sudo mkdir /var/www
sudo chown www-data:www-data /var/www

sudo nano /var/www/index.html
sudo nano /etc/caddy/Caddyfile

sudo service caddy start
sudo service caddy restart
sudo service caddy status

2.2 更改v2ray伺服器配置
sudo nano /etc/v2ray/config.json
sudo service v2ray restart

說明:
1. 在文件/etc/v2ray/config.json中添加(參考文獻1):

“streamSettings”: {
“network”: “ws”,
“wsSettings”: {
“path”: “/ray”
}
}

即變成如下形式的內容:

{
“inbounds”: [
{
“port”: 10000,
“listen”:”127.0.0.1″,
“protocol”: “vmess”,
“settings”: {
“clients”: [
{
“id”: “b831381d-6324-4d53-ad4f-8cda48b30811”,
“alterId”: 64
}
]
},
“streamSettings”: {
“network”: “ws”,
“wsSettings”: {
“path”: “/ray”
}
}
}
],
“outbounds”: [
{
“protocol”: “freedom”,
“settings”: {}
}
]
}

 2 文件Caddyfile參考內容:
ytvideo2.tk {
root /var/www/
tls [email protected]
gzip
protocols tls1.2 tls1.3
ciphers ECDHE-ECDSA-AES128-GCM-SHA256 ECDHE-RSA-AES128-GCM-SHA256 ECDHE-ECDSA-AES256-GCM-SHA384 ECDHE-RSA-AES256-GCM-SHA384 ECDHE-ECDSA-WITH-CHACHA20-POLY1305 ECDHE-RSA-WITH-CHACHA20-POLY1305

 proxy /ray localhost:10000 {
websocket
header_upstream -Origin
}
}

註: Caddyfile的埠和/etc/v2ray/config.json的埠要一致,比如都是10000。

3. 如要配置CDN,可參考文獻3

 參考:
1. https://guide.v2fly.org/advanced/wss_and_web.html#%E9%85%8D%E7%BD%AE
2. https://www.cloudbooklet.com/install-caddy-with-php-https-using-letsencrypt-on-ubuntu/
3. https://melty.land/blog/caddy-and-cloudflare .